Will I be able to park at West Pearl?

Parking is available at the parking garages at 11th & Spruce and 11th & Walnut, as well as on the street on Walnut, Pearl, 11th, and 9th, and in the parking lot under the St. Julien Hotel, as well as on neighboring streets.

How will businesses on West Pearl be able to get deliveries?

Businesses have 24/7 backdoor access to the alleys on either side of the street, and the full street is also open for deliveries during several key hours every day.

How will people with disabilities be able to access West Pearl businesses?

Parking for folks with a disability parking pass will be available on 10th Street between Spruce Street and Morrison Alley (directly to the north of Pearl). Patrons can also be safely dropped off at either end of West Pearl, or on 10th Street at Morrison Alley.

Will delivery drivers / DoorDash drivers be able to easily pick up from businesses?

Delivery drivers or couriers can utilize the marked loading zones on the alleys parallel to West Pearl to quickly access businesses to pick up orders.

How can I get to West Pearl by bus?

RTD will run within a block of West Pearl.

Can I ride my bike to West Pearl?

Yes! Not only to West Pearl, but on it as well! West Pearl is very welcoming to all kinds of alt-transportation methods and making sure there is space for everyone.

Are dogs allowed on West Pearl?

Dogs and pets are welcome at West Pearl! Unlike the rest of the pedestrian mall, West Pearl is a pet-friendly zone.

Is West Pearl kid-friendly?

Yes! Kids are welcome to run around, play hopscotch, dance to street performers, and enjoy being young.
